Hi all, as kind of side-quest I have been working to write a JNI-based Jython-launcher with the mid-term goal to replace the current one that needs to bundle CPython. (I couldn't resist to make up some fancy development-name for the project.) It turned out to be much harder than I thought, but finally, here is kind of a prototype (for now linux only). I would appreciate some testing from the linux-users among you, before I start porting it to windows. Take a look at https://github.com/Stewori/LiJy-launch (I wanna see some stars!) Yes, the source code needs lots of clean-up; first do things right ;) I'd like to see this become the default-launcher in Jython 2.7.1, but unfortunately there might be license issues. It was infeasible to write this launcher without including source-code from Open JDK, which is released under GPLv2 with classpath exception. However this would not be infective for Jython as there is the classpath exception and Jython would not link to the launcher anyway (it's only the other way round). Only thing is that if Jython would distribute this launcher, it would have to clarify that the launcher is GPLv2 with classpath exception as opposed to the rest of Jython and include the according license text-file. I suppose this should be okay, what do you think?
